Kylie Jenner was clearly displeased when host Alan Cumming made a cheeky joke at the 2026 BAFTA Awards on Sunday.
During the British Academy Film Awards ceremony at London’s Royal Festival Hall, Cumming slipped through the A-list audience and handed out “very British snacks”.
When it came to Timothée Chalamet and Jenner, the Traitors host handed him a British pub snack scampi fries, while the makeup mogul was given a giant jammy dodger.
A jammy dodger is a popular British shortbread biscuit sandwich filled with raspberry or strawberry flavored jam with a heart-shaped cut on top.
“Kylie, have you ever had your gums glued to a giant Jamie Dozier?” he asked her before giving her a treat.
She shook her head no in surprise, then accepted the treat and murmured, “Thank you.”
